自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(5)
  • 收藏
  • 关注

原创 算法:计数,编码,解码

杨辉三角给定n求出中所有项的系数?方法一:利用递推,根据规律,可以从第一层开始逐个的推导出系数,但我们只需要第n行的系数,却把n行所有的系数都求出来了,复杂度为O(n2)。方法二:利用等式,从开始从左往右递推,这样就得到第n行的所有系数。约数个数给定n,求n的正约数个数?首先要得到n唯一分解式,每个素因子的选择情况有0,1,2…ak共ak

2014-08-16 21:43:56 633

原创 数论算法初步理解(1)

最大公约数和最小公倍数最大公约数gcd(a,b)遍历法:取两个数的最小值作为遍历的起点,减一逐个数的尝试,直到能够找到最大公约数,其遍历次数为min{a,b}欧几里德算法(辗转相除法Euclidean algorithm):第一步:用较大的数m除以较小的数n得到一个商q0和一个余数r0;第二步:若r0=0,则n为m,n的最大公因数

2014-08-15 20:24:50 412

原创 Linux基础

Linux系统是黑客的系统,代码开源,所有的程序员都可以对其进行开发。操作系统(OS)是一种作为用户和计算机之间接口的软件程序。操作系统功能:命令解释(对命令进行解析执行),进程管理(运行程序的执行管理),内存管理,输入/输出(I/O)操作盒外围设备管理(硬件管理,显示管理),文件管理(对文件的调用等)关机方法shutdown –h now 关机sh

2014-08-14 21:16:27 275

原创 Linux下C程序开发环境笔记

C语言在Linux系统的地位:Liinux的操作系统内核主要是用C写的,并且Linux下的很多软件也是C写的,如开源数据库,MySQL,Apache(web服务器)开发环境构成编辑器:不同版本都包括VI,并且用法类似,采用VI作为编辑器编译器:免费主流选择GNU C/C++编译器gcc(发现语法错误)调试器:应用广泛的gdb(发现逻辑错误)函数库

2014-08-12 12:53:53 360

原创 基于数据中心的VM迁移算法总结(1)

http://detail.tmall.com/item.htm?spm=a220m.1000858.1000725.2.lMpWxy&id=36026409973&areaId=510100&cat_id=52638018&rn=6e69f7286aeb2c4837c0f94fb8fd8191&user_id=290394574&is_b=1

2014-08-03 21:31:14 2331

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除